"tremulus is a storytelling game of lovecraftian horror. Since the earliest parts of the year, I have allowed it to grow and gestate into something different from anything I’ve developed before or anything my studio has released. At its core, it is a pick up and play roleplaying game running on a modified design of Apocalypse World. You can get going in a matter of minutes—no more time than it takes to set up most board games—and each player needs only a pair of dice, a dossier, and an open mind. The Keeper needs no dice whatsoever, only scratch paper, a pen, and a penchant for nightmare."
